Overview

Pentoxifylline + tocopherol is a combination therapy investigated for its potential anti-fibrotic effects in patients with chronic hepatitis C. Pentoxifylline is a non-selective phosphodiesterase inhibitor that improves blood rheology and possesses anti-inflammatory properties, specifically by inhibiting the production of tumor necrosis factor-alpha (TNF-alpha) and potentially modulating transforming growth factor-beta (TGF-beta) signaling. Tocopherol (Vitamin E) is a lipid-soluble antioxidant that helps mitigate oxidative stress, a key driver of hepatic stellate cell activation and subsequent collagen deposition. The French National Agency for Research on AIDS and Viral Hepatitis (ANRS) sponsored a Phase 3, double-blind, placebo-controlled trial (NCT00119119) to evaluate whether a 12-month regimen of this combination could reduce liver fibrosis in patients who were non-responders or intolerant to standard interferon-alfa and ribavirin therapy.
